    Title: National Volatile Organic Compound Emission Standards for 
Consumer Products (Renewal).
    ICR Numbers: EPA ICR Number 1764.05, OMB Control Number 2060-0348.
    ICR Status: This ICR is scheduled to expire on February 28, 2011. 
Under OMB regulations, the Agency may continue to conduct or sponsor 
the collection of information while this submission is pending at OMB. 
An Agency may not conduct or sponsor, and a person is not required to 
respond to, a collection of information unless it displays a currently 
valid OMB control number. The OMB control numbers for EPA's regulations 
in title 40 of the CFR, after appearing in the Federal Register when 
approved, are listed in 40 CFR part 9, and displayed either by 
publication in the Federal Register or by other appropriate means, such 
as on the related collection instrument or form, if applicable. The 
display of OMB control numbers in certain EPA regulations is 
consolidated in 40 CFR part 9.
    Abstract: The information collection includes initial reports and 
periodic recordkeeping necessary for EPA to ensure compliance with 
Federal standards for volatile organic compounds in consumer products. 
Respondents are manufacturers, distributors, and importers of consumer 
products. Responses to the collection are mandatory under 40 CFR part 
59, subpart C, National Volatile Organic Compound Emission Standards 
for Consumer Products. All information submitted to the EPA for which a 
claim of confidentiality is made will be safeguarded according to the 
Agency policies set forth in 40 CFR part 2, subpart B, Confidentiality 
of Business Information.

    Respondents/Affected Entities: Manufacturers and importers of 
consumer products.
    Estimated Number of Respondents: 732.
    Frequency of Response: On occasion.
    Estimated Total Annual Hour Burden: 29,613.
    Estimated Total Annual Cost: $1,364,069 in labor costs; there are 
no capital/startup costs or O&M costs associated with this ICR.
    Changes in the Estimates: There is no change in the labor hours or 
capital and O&M costs to the respondents in this ICR compared to the 
previous ICR because the regulations have not changed over the past 
three years and are not anticipated to change over the next three 
years. However, the change in labor costs for industry and EPA is due 
to the use of more current labor rates.
